Odds are the most fundamental thing to understand before placing any bet at AS8 Game. They do two jobs simultaneously: they tell you the probability the platform is assigning to an outcome, and they tell you how much you'll be paid if you're right. Getting comfortable with how to read odds quickly is probably the single most useful skill a new bettor can develop.
AS8 Game uses decimal odds, which are the clearest format for most players. The number shown next to a selection is a multiplier applied to your stake. If you bet 1,000 PKR on a team at odds of 2.50, your total return is 2,500 PKR — meaning your profit is 1,500 PKR. The formula is always: Stake × Odds = Total Return. Profit is that total return minus your original stake.

To convert decimal odds to implied probability: divide 1 by the odds. Odds of 2.00 = 50% implied probability. Odds of 4.00 = 25%. If you believe the actual probability of an outcome is higher than what the odds imply, that selection offers value — and value is what you're always looking for when betting at AS8 Game.

For PSL specifically, there are a few factors consistently worth weighing. Home advantage matters in franchise cricket — teams playing in their home city tend to draw crowds that create atmosphere and familiarity that visiting sides don't always handle comfortably. Pitch type at different PSL venues varies meaningfully: Lahore's Gaddafi Stadium has historically produced high-scoring games while some other venues play slower. Knowing these differences before a match gives you a more grounded view of over/under run markets than just looking at team rankings.
Team selection news, released a couple of hours before match time, is one of the most valuable pieces of pre-match information for live betting preparation. If a key fast bowler is rested or an opening batsman is dropped, the impact on first-innings totals and win probabilities can be significant — and the markets at AS8 Game will adjust, but there's often a window right after that news breaks where the odds haven't fully caught up.

Accumulators are popular because the potential payouts are compelling — combining four or five selections at around 1.80–2.20 each can produce total odds of 10 to 20 times your stake. The risk is that every single leg must win. A sensible approach is to keep accumulator stakes small — perhaps 10–15% of what you'd bet on a single — and to only include selections you'd be comfortable betting individually. Padding an acca with a "sure thing" at 1.10 odds barely moves the overall return but adds another point of failure.
Value in betting means the odds offered are higher than the true probability of an outcome. If you genuinely believe Pakistan has a 65% chance of winning a T20 but the odds imply only 50%, that selection has positive expected value. Over many bets, finding and backing value consistently is what separates disciplined bettors from those who rely purely on luck. At AS8 Game, the depth of cricket markets provides many opportunities to find these spots if you do your homework before each match.

Live in-play betting deserves specific attention because it's one of the fastest-growing bet types at AS8 Game and one of the most misused. The appeal is obvious: odds shift dramatically during a match, and if you're watching carefully, you can sometimes identify a price that clearly doesn't reflect what's actually happening on the field. A team loses two early wickets but both were soft dismissals and the match is clearly still open — if the odds have swung too far toward the fielding side, there may be value in backing the batting team at the new, higher odds.
The danger with in-play betting is speed. Odds move fast and it's easy to click confirm on a bet you haven't fully thought through because you're reacting to a moment rather than assessing a situation. The discipline that applies to pre-match betting — do I genuinely believe the probability here is better than what the odds imply? — applies equally to in-play, it just has to happen faster. Setting a rule for yourself, such as only placing in-play bets during natural breaks in play (end of over, half-time, drinks break), can help slow the decision process down enough to avoid purely reactive bets.
Football betting at AS8 Game follows a different rhythm to cricket and is worth understanding separately if you intend to use those markets. Football is lower-scoring, which means single-goal swings are enormously significant for match result bets — a 70th-minute goal can completely change the odds picture. Over/under markets in football, particularly for lower-scoring leagues, require a solid understanding of defensive setups and how teams approach away games. Asian handicap markets, which split handicaps into half-goal increments to remove the draw as an outcome, are popular with experienced football bettors because they reduce the vig and provide cleaner two-way markets.
Esports betting is the third significant pillar of the AS8 Game Bet section. For younger users who grew up watching CS2 tournaments or PUBG Mobile competitive play, these markets can actually represent their strongest area of knowledge. The same principles apply: if you know the meta, follow team rosters and understand how map pools work in CS2, you have a legitimate knowledge edge. Esports odds are sometimes less efficiently priced than major cricket or football markets simply because the pool of professional analysts is smaller, which creates more opportunities for informed bettors.
